TBI Outstanding Shares Analysis

What is the Trend in TBI`s Outstanding Shares?

TrueBlue`s outstanding shares have decreased by approximately -3.30% annually over the past 5 years (Correlation: -90.0%), positively influencing stock price.

Has TrueBlue ever had a Stock Split?

Yes, last Stock Split was on 1999-07-13 with a factor of 3:2. This stock split increased the number of shares and lowered the price per share by a ratio of 1.5.
